The Applications & Business Development Architect will be responsible for applications, technical support, product demonstrations in addition to designing and commissioning Theory Audio Design and Theory Professional systems. This role requires an experienced audio professional who has a proven track record of success across multiple audio disciplines. The ideal candidate will have strong technical knowledge and project management skills, along with the ability to lead teams and collaborate effectively with clients, contractors, and vendors.
This position involves travel and working in unique environments.

- Proven experience as an Applications Engineer
specifically for audiovisual installation projects. -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ering, Project Management,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in designing, commissioning & troubleshooting AV system installations.
- Strong knowledge of AV systems, networked audio, and industry standards.
- CTS certification is highly desirable.
- Ability to travel internationally.
- Excellent organizational, leadership, and communication skills
. - Knowledge and proficiency in audio-over-IP protocols and system implementation, especially Dante and AES 67”.
- Proficiency in audio disciplines and familiarity with EASE, CAD, or similar design software.
- Project management abilities are highly desirable.
